Abstract
A line pattern in a free group is defined by a malnormal collection of cyclic subgroups. Otal defined a decomposition space associated to a line pattern. We provide an algorithm that computes a presentation for the \v{C}ech cohomology of , thought of as a -module. This answers a relative version of a question of Epstein about boundaries of hyperbolic groups.
